Product Overview: Fluke 378FC Harmonic and Energy Efficiency Screening Clamp Meter
Measures voltage and current with FieldSense™ technology
The Fluke 378 FC True RMS Clamp Meter utilizes FieldSense™ technology to make testing faster and safer without touching live conductors. Get accurate voltage and current measurements through the jaws. Simply clamp the black test lead to any electrical ground and hold the jaws on the conductor to view reliable, accurate voltage and current values on the display.
Power quality indicator shows if there is a problem with the device or power cord
The 378 FC clamp meter has a unique PQ feature that automatically detects power quality problems. When making FieldSense measurements, the 378 FC detects and displays power quality problems related to current, voltage, power factor, or any combination of the three. You can quickly determine if the problem is with the upstream supply side or the downstream equipment.

Measuring Very High Currents with the iFlex® Probe
With the included iFlex Flexible Current Probe, you can measure AC currents up to 2500 A. The iFlex Flexible Current Probe is designed to measure AC currents up to 2500 A. Measure crowded wiring closets and large conductors easily with the iFlex probe.

Record, analyze and share results using FlukeConnect® software
With Fluke Connect software, you can remotely record, trend, and monitor measurements to identify intermittent failures. With Fluke Connect, you can also collect data as the basis for preventive maintenance programs.
